About this property

Can't beat the location and value for the price! One of the lowest HOAs in the area. Private and secure gated condominium of only 10 units surrounding the fully enclosed courtyard. Designated parking on level. First floor entry. Open concept dining, kitchen, and living room with wood burning fireplace and privately fenced backyard patio space. Half bath for convenience. New LVP flooring through, new paint, new lighting, and new custom kitchen with expanded pantry. Second level hosts two spacious bedrooms on separate wings split with full and newly renovated bathroom, plus full size stackable laundry. Third floor lofted bonus room fitting for a office, reading library, or exercise space with generous walk out balcony deck to enjoy sunrises and sunsets. Low HOA. Steps away from The Shops of Highland Park, Equinox, and The Katy Trail. Minutes from SMU, Uptown, and Downtown Dallas. Easy access to Dallas North Tollway and 75. Dallas

The largest metro area in Texas, Dallas–Fort Worth blends corporate muscle with suburban sprawl and long-run growth. Anchored by Fortune 500 headquarters, two major airports, and sprawling master-planned communities, the region stretches from Uptown Dallas high-rises to Fort Worth’s historic Stockyards.

DFW is where finance meets freight, tech meets transportation, and new subdivisions seem to rise as quickly as new logistics hubs. It’s a metro defined by scale — in jobs, rooftops, and opportunity.
